Minister Crawford to Attend Caribbean Exporters' Colloquium in Barbados

Release Date: 
Friday, November 7, 2014 - 14:45

Kingston, Jamaica: November 7, 2014 – State Minister in the Ministry of Tourism and Entertainment, the Hon. Damion Crawford, has been invited by the Caribbean Export Development Agency (CEDA) to attend the second Caribbean Exporters' Colloquium in Bridgetown, Barbados, from November 11 – 12, 2014. He will depart the island on Monday, November 10, 2014.

The two-day Colloquium, being held under the theme “Building Economic Resilience in the Caribbean”, is intended to provide Caribbean counties with a road map for future economic growth.   The forum will focus on examining among other issues, the state of regional exports, private sector advocacy, innovation and entrepreneurship, branding and intellectual property protection, and key issues affecting competitiveness.

Minister Crawford will be a panelist on one of the Colloquium’s series of interactive discussions titled “Clearing the Hurdles:   Key Issues Affecting Caribbean Private Sector Competitiveness.”   The session will identify specific challenges that may stymie the ability of the private sector to be competitive with the objective of generating recommendations that will enable them to play a greater role in regional economic development.

This event will bring together over 100 leading Caribbean business persons, policymakers, business support organizations, regional and international development organizations and political leaders from all CARIFORUM countries.

State Minister Crawford will return to the island on Sunday, November 16, 2014.
